Ingredients

3 eggs
3/4 cup white sugar
3/4 cup melted butter
1 teaspoon anise extract
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
3/4 cup all-purpose flour
1 teaspoon baking powder

Instructions

1.Preheat the pizzelle iron according to manufacturer's instructions.
2.In a large mixing bowl, beat the eggs and sugar until smooth.
3.Add the melted butter, anise extract, and vanilla extract and mix until well combined.
4.Add the flour and baking powder to the wet ingredients, mixing until a smooth batter forms.
5.Spoon a small amount of batter into each pizzelle mold, close the iron, and cook for about 1-2 minutes, or until golden brown.
6.Remove the pizzelle from the mold and cool on a wire rack before serving.
